A minor little project today.

I bought the game Beamrider years ago for my Atari 8Bit machine. It was a loose cartridge so no instructions, and whilst the cart appeared to work, I could never get the game to play.

I tried to pull it apart wanting to see if I could fix it and not realising it was screwed together under the label I managed to break the back shell badly.

And of course once I got the back off it turned out to be a glop top so I couldn't do much anyway.

I later discovered the cart worked and that the game was started in a completely different way to most Atari games, and I'd damaged a perfectly good cartridge shell.

I wasn't so good at figuring these things out BITD and I've learned a lot since then.
